Iron ore is present in a number of places and geologic settings within Wisconsin. Iron ore can be defined on the basis of its iron content into low-grade ore (taconite), which commonly contains 25 to 35% iron, and high-grade ore, which contains 50 to 70% iron. The Jackson County Iron Company mine (top) began operating near Black River Falls in the late 1960s, before modern mining regulation existed. It closed in the early 1980s and gradually filled with water.
